Why in gods name are you driving on roads in 4 wheel drive? Yeah it's gonna kick and buck and BREAK ****! You can't drive on pavement when in 4x4 I can't stress this enough. Your wheels when you turn turn at different speeds. The outside wheel turns faster and the inside turns slower. When in 4 wheel drive it tries to turn them at the same speed, Hence the bucking and "kicking out" you WILL break stuff if you keep doing that.
